Canada offers two major intakes for international students applying to universities and colleges:
π
Fall Intake β Starts in September (Application deadlines: January β April)
π
Winter Intake β Starts in January (Application deadlines: June β September)
Some institutions also offer a Summer Intake (May), but it is available for limited programs.
π Processing Time:
- Universities: 8-12 weeks
- Colleges: 2-4 weeks
Checklist of Documents Required for Admission
For Bachelorβs & Masterβs Programs (University Admission)
β Academic Transcripts:
- 10th Grade Certificate (Attested by the Principal in a sealed envelope)
- 12th Grade/Diploma Certificate (Attested by the Principal in a sealed envelope)
- Bachelor’s/Masterβs Degree β Individual mark sheets (Attested by Controller/Registrar in a sealed envelope)
- Consolidated Mark Sheet/Provisional/Degree/Course Completion Certificate (Attested by Controller/Registrar in a sealed envelope)
β English Language Proficiency Test:
- IELTS/TOEFL/PTE β Copy with attestation (Official score reporting to the university is required)
- GRE/GMAT (if applicable) β Copy with attestation
β
Letters of Recommendation (LORs) β Three Required (in sealed covers)
1οΈβ£ From a Professor/Assistant Professor/Lecturer who has taught the student
2οΈβ£ From the Head of Department (HOD)
3οΈβ£ From the Principal
β
Other Required Documents:
π Statement of Purpose (SOP) β A well-written SOP explaining your academic background, career goals, and reasons for choosing Canada.
π CV/Resume β Updated resume with academic and professional details.
π Experience Letter (if applicable) β Required for master’s applicants with work experience.
π Passport Copy (First & Last Pages) β With attestation.
π Extra-Curricular Certificates (if any).
π Passport Size Photographs.
For Diploma & College Programs
β Academic Transcripts:
- 10th Grade Certificate (Attested by the Principal in a sealed envelope)
- 12th Grade/Diploma Certificate (Attested by the Principal in a sealed envelope)
- Bachelor’s/Masterβs Individual & Consolidated Mark Sheet (if applicable)
- Provisional Certificate or Degree Certificate (if applicable)
β English Language Proficiency Test:
- IELTS/TOEFL/PTE β Copy with attestation
β
Letters of Recommendation (LORs) β Three Required (in sealed covers)
1οΈβ£ From a Professor/Assistant Professor/Lecturer/Teacher
2οΈβ£ From the Head of Department (HOD)
3οΈβ£ From the Principal
β
Other Required Documents:
π Statement of Purpose (SOP).
π CV/Resume β Updated resume with academic and personal details.
π Passport Copy (First & Last Pages) β With attestation.
π Passport Size Photographs.
Important Notes:
- Attestation is mandatory for academic documents. Ensure they are in sealed envelopes.
- SOP and LORs play a crucial role in securing admission, so they must be well-structured.
- Ensure timely submission of documents to meet university deadlines.
- Check for additional program-specific requirements, such as portfolios (for arts/design programs) or research proposals (for Ph.D. programs).
